Wire – “Red Barked Tree” – [Pink Flag Records]35 years on, Wire (a trio now) is still rolling out their distinctive art-damaged rock. No one else has ever matched their ability to combine pop melodies with crushing noise and layered textures. The tracks here range from upbeat and catchy to dense, dark, and disturbing–typical for Wire and just the way I like it. Colin Newman’s vocals and cryptic lyrics are out front, and his guitar dominates the sound. Bassist/vocalist Graham Lewis sings a couple of songs (1,6) that are OK, but nothing special, although it’s kind of fun to hear a catchy song whose chorus goes “fuck off out of my face….” Robert (Gotobed) Grey’s uncomplicated metronomic drumming is a key ingredient too. I miss Bruce Gilbert’s noisy contributions, but am impressed by the way Newman and Lewis carry on, building up thick layers of guitars (and “various”, whatever that is) to give this music real weight. If you’re a Wire fan, you’ll probably agree this is a pretty solid release. Comment on this review |
